Figure 4. Assessment of differences in factor means using the SEM multiple-groups approach. Note: Groups 0 and 1 are asthmatics with married parents and asthmatics with recently divorced parents, respectively. V1 through V4 are the disengagement, denial, problem-focused coping, and seeking social support scales, respectively. F1 and F2 are the avoidant and active coping factors, respectively. The values on the paths between the estimated population mean (
) and the factors are the estimated population factor means. For both MI and MU, they are assigned a value of zero in group 0. For MI, the estimates for group 1 are unconstrained and allowed to differ from the estimates for group 0. For MC, the estimates for group 1 are constrained to be the same as the estimates for group 0 (i.e., 0). The values on the paths between the intercepts and the scales are the estimated population intercepts and are constrained to be equal across groups for both models.
